Geometric modularity has recently been conjectured to be a characteristic feature for flux vacua with W=0. This paper provides support for the conjecture by computing motivic modular forms in a direct way for several string compactifications for which such vacua are known to exist. The analysis of some Calabi-Yau manifolds which do not admit supersymmetric flux vacua shows that the reverse of the conjecture does not hold.
